Airport Flashmob for Kinlay House

Our first day on the challenge was a great success. It got off to a rocky start as we struggled to find a guest arriving at a suitable time at the airport to surprise with a welcome. In theory our master plan was seamless...emailing all guests due to check-in that day with the promise of a free airport shuttle if they replied with their arrival times. Unfortunately those that did were arriving at 5am so it was necessary for plan B!!

PLAN B:

In the spirit of the original flashmob by the improve crew; we decided that we would go to the arrivals area and ask those waiting who they were waiting for. Balloons and party hats were a plenty and good humour all round. We practiced our singing and dancing routine (as we're all professional flashmobbers now! ha!).
We found two families waiting for 4 German Exchange Students....BINGO!

We waited with baited breadth until finally we got the signal. We surged forward, an unstoppable force of joy and jubilation, jumping, singing, blowing horns. The girls were naturally shocked and looked terrified at first. It wasn't until they saw their names on our welcome banner that the penny dropped but even then they were a little a-daze! Much to our amusement they arrived in two pairs and so we had the opportunity to recreate our flashmob welcome just a few minutes after for the second time!

The adrenalin was racing through us all...what a buzz...we thought as we got back on Over The Top Tour's trusty bus service! We got back to Kinlay and were warmly welcomed. We enjoyed some free beverages of the tasty sort.

Next Darkey Kelly's, an adjoining pub treated us to a dinner fit for queens in exchange for a 30 minute set!

Day one in the bag!!
